According to the Asexual Visibility and Education Network (AVEN), “an asexual person is a person who does not experience sexual attraction.”Allosexual, by contrast, is a term used in the asexual community for a person who experiences sexual attraction. (Allo–is a prefix meaning “other.”)...
It's also possible that you could identify as aromantic. It means you don't feel any romantic attraction to others and don't want that type of close emotional relationship. Some people say "aro," for short. Being asexual doesn’t mean that you have an aversion to sex. It simply means...
